At the heart of the evening is Cookie Queens, a documentary directed by Alysa Nahmias. The film follows four girls during Girl Scout Cookie season as they chase big sales goals, navigate pressure, and discover what ambition looks like when childhood and business collide. Sundance described the film as part of its 2026 Family Matinee section, spotlighting the girls’ families, goals, doubts, and dreams.
The film was supported by the Free People Creative Spirit Fund, which is part of Free People’s broader initiative to support creative minds through grants. Free People partnered with the Sundance Institute Documentary Film Program to support five women documentary filmmakers, with recipients receiving $25,000 grants and mentorship from Sundance’s Documentary Film Program.
